The Cost Breakdown of Lithium-ion Batteries
A typical lithium-ion battery''s cost structure includes:
- Raw materials (50-60%): Lithium, cobalt, nickel
- Cell production (20-25%)
- Battery management systems (10-15%)
- Assembly and testing (5-10%)
"Lithium alone accounts for 30-40% of total battery material costs, making it the single largest expense in energy storage solutions." - BloombergNEF 2023 Report
Key Factors Influencing Lithium Costs
1. Geopolitical Dynamics
The "lithium triangle" (Chile, Argentina, Bolivia) controls 58% of global reserves. Recent export restrictions have created price volatility, with lithium carbonate prices swinging between $70,000-$80,000/ton in 2022-2023.
2. Technological Advancements
Innovations like solid-state batteries and lithium iron phosphate (LFP) chemistries are reshaping cost ratios:
Battery Type | Lithium Content | Cost ($/kWh) |
---|---|---|
NMC 811 | 12% | 128 |
LFP | 8% | 105 |
Solid-State (Proto) | 5% | 240 |
Industry-Specific Cost Challenges
Different sectors face unique lithium cost pressures:
- EV Manufacturers: 60-70kWh battery packs require 10-15kg lithium
- Solar Farms: 100MWh systems need 7-8 metric tons lithium
- Consumer Electronics: 5% annual cost reduction through recycling

Future Outlook and Cost Projections
The lithium cost ratio is expected to decline to 25-30% by 2030 due to:
- Improved mining efficiency
- Recycling rate increases (projected 50% recovery by 2027)
- Alternative battery chemistries
Did you know? Sodium-ion batteries already compete in stationary storage with 40% lower lithium dependency, though energy density remains a challenge.
